Starting the Day: From Zagreb to Ljubljana
The day begins at 8:00 am, with a pickup from your hotel or Zrinjevac park. The ride to Ljubljana lasts about an hour and a half, offering a chance to settle in and enjoy the Slovenian countryside. Traveling in a private, air-conditioned vehicle means you won’t be cramped, and the scenery whizzes by in comfort. Expect a smooth border crossing between Croatia and Slovenia — the driver handles the logistics, so you can relax.
Ljubljana Old Town: A View into Slovenia’s Capital
The first stop is Ljubljana’s Old Town, a vibrant hub of pastel-colored buildings, cobblestone streets, and lively cafes. This part of the tour lasts about 1.5 hours, led by a licensed local guide who will point out highlights like Preseren Square and the pink Catholic Church, and take you to Ljubljana Castle via a funicular ride.
The castle offers panoramic views of the city and, if weather permits, sights of the Julian Alps. Reviews frequently praise guides like Karlo, who bring local stories alive and offer personal recommendations for wandering or dining afterward.
Iconic Landmarks: Dragon Bridge and Ljubljana Cathedral
Next, you’ll walk to the Dragon Bridge, one of Ljubljana’s most recognizable structures, where a statue of a dragon perches dramatically over the river. It’s a quick stop but a favorite for photos. Then, you might visit the Cathedral of St. Nicholas — though the admission isn’t included, many find it worth a quick look for its historical significance.
Free Time in Ljubljana
The tour offers 1.5 hours to explore at your own pace. You might choose to sit at a café, sample local cuisine, or browse boutique shops. Many reviewers mention how this freedom allows for authentic experiences, like trying Slovenian desserts or a quick tapas-style snack. It’s the perfect chance to absorb the city’s lively atmosphere without feeling rushed.
Journey to Lake Bled: A Fairytale Scene
After Ljubljana, your driver guides you through scenic landscapes toward Lake Bled, an enchanting town that looks like it belongs in a fairy tale. As you travel, your guide shares stories about the area’s history and legends, setting the tone for the next stops.
Bled Castle: Medieval Marvel
Once at Bled, the castle — perched high above the lake — awaits. The visit includes entry to the castle, where you can explore the printing press shop, forge, bee-house, and museum. The views from Bled Castle are stunning, offering a perfect backdrop for memorable photos.
Lake Bled: The Heart of the Tour
You get about an hour and a half to enjoy Lake Bled, famous for its tiny island topped by a church and a medieval castle that seems to float on the water. You’ll likely want to sample the iconic Bled cream cake, which reviewers rave about as a delicious highlight of the day. The lake’s serene setting and the backdrop of the Julian Alps make it a photographer’s paradise.

Frequently Asked Questions
How early should I book this tour?
Most travelers reserve about 101 days in advance, suggesting it’s popular and worth planning ahead, especially during peak seasons.
What’s included in the price?
The tour price covers private transfer, guided sightseeing in Ljubljana, castle admissions, bottled water, and pickup/drop-off service. Food and drinks are not included.
Is this tour suitable for all ages?
Yes, most travelers can participate, though some walking and steep parts are involved. It’s ideal for those comfortable with moderate activity.
What should I bring?
Bring your passport, comfortable walking shoes, a camera, and some cash for optional purchases or meals during free time.
Are there any additional costs?
Optional visits like the Ljubljana Cathedral are not included, and food or extra souvenirs are extra.
Can I customize this tour?
Since it’s private, you can discuss specific interests with your guide beforehand, making the experience more personalized.
What is the weather policy?
The tour requires good weather; if canceled due to rain or poor conditions, you’ll be offered a different date or a full refund.
How long is the free time at Lake Bled?
You’ll have about 1.5 hours — enough to stroll, take photos, and enjoy a local treat.
Is there a lunch break?
The tour includes sightseeing and free time, but meals are on your own, so plan accordingly for lunch or snacks.
